For the second consecutive year, Louisiana ranks number two in the nation for infrastructure investment, this according to Site Selection Magazine’s Global Groundwork Index.  Economic Development Secretary Don Pierson says the publication recognizes the state’s significant enhancements through recent initiatives.

The St. Tammany Parish Sheriff’s Office arrested one of their own this morning when Deputy Chief Gregory Longino was pulled over driving 100 miles per hour on the Causeway Bridge. He was also arrested on suspicion of DUI. Longino, a 29 year old veteran with the department, was not on duty and in his personal vehicle. He was booked into the St. Tammany Parish Jail and is being held on a $2,500 bond.
